Acceleration=force divided by mass.
The above is Newtons second law.
Acceleration is also the change in velocity over the change in time, so it can also be stated as
a=(final velocity - initial velocity)/(elapsed time)

Equation: Force=Mass X Acceleration If you are looking for the force, use the equation as is. To find the following, it's assumed that you are given the other two values: Mass= Force / Acceleration Acceleration= Force / Mass Remember your labels in your calculations.
